Palm Springs North vs West Miami
A side-by-side comparison of Palm Springs North and West Miami: population, income, housing, and more.
Palm Springs North and West Miami are places in Florida.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
West Miami has the higher population (7,077 vs 5,291 in Palm Springs North). Palm Springs North has the higher median household income ($97,083 vs $56,509 in West Miami). Palm Springs North has the higher median home value ($476,500 vs $436,700 in West Miami).
